How Common Is The Last Name Elmos? popularity and diffusion
Elmos is the 2,436,415th most widely held last name internationally, borne by approximately 1 in 117,541,063 people. This last name occurs predominantly in The Americas, where 73 percent of Elmos are found; 52 percent are found in South America and 52 percent are found in Luso-South America. Elmos is also the 732,696th most widely held first name internationally. It is borne by 157 people.
This surname is most commonly used in Brazil, where it is held by 32 people, or 1 in 6,689,823. In Brazil Elmos is primarily found in: Amazonas, where 97 percent reside and São Paulo, where 3 percent reside. Aside from Brazil this surname occurs in 8 countries. It is also found in The United States, where 19 percent reside and Tanzania, where 15 percent reside.
